Paris Saint-Germain goalkeeper Gianluigi Donnarumma has rejected a contract extension offer, with Man City and Bayern Munich keen.
This according to Italian broadcaster SportMediaset, via FCInterNews.
Italian international goalkeeper Gianluigi Donnarumma is under contract with Paris Saint-Germain until the end of next June.
However, contract extension talks between the 26-year-old and the reigning Champions League holders haven’t taken off.
SportMediaset report that Donnarumma has rejected PSG’s most recent offer for an extension. He is still holding out for a higher fee.
Therefore, it is looking as though the Parisians face a choice: cash in on Donnarumma now, or lose him on a free transfer next summer.
Furthermore, the fact that PSG are set to sign Lille keeper Lucas Chevallier is a clear sign that they are prepared for the loss of Donnarumma.

The Nerazzurri have reportedly been plotting an audacious free transfer move for the Italian international should he be available next summer.
However, with Donnarumma looking to be on the market, the interest is growing among Europe’s heavy-hitters in signing the 26-year-old this summer.
SportMediaset report that Manchester City are ready to offer around €25-30 million to sign Donnarumma.
Meanwhile, Bayern Munich are also keen on the former AC Milan keeper.
